Regular cleaning

The University’s premises are cleaned regularly during term time. Here are examples of what is included in the regular cleaning.

Open-plan offices and individual offices are cleaned weekly during term time.

Cleaning includes

  • floor cleaning
  • vacuuming of carpets
  • emptying of recycling units
  • cleaning of door handles and light switches.

Activity-based workplaces are cleaned daily during term time.

Cleaning includes

  • emptying of recycling units
  • floor cleaning
  • vacuuming of carpets
  • wiping of tables, furniture and clear surfaces
  • wiping of computer screens
  • cleaning of door handles and light switches
  • cleaning of glass partitions (cleaned monthly).

Kitchenettes and lunch rooms are cleaned daily during term time.

Cleaning includes

  • emptying of waste bins and cleaning of recycling units
  • floor cleaning
  • wiping of tables and clear surfaces
  • cleaning of microwave ovens in staff areas (cleaned weekly).

Toilets and anterooms are cleaned daily.

Cleaning includes

  • emptying of paper and sanitary bins
  • floor cleaning using specialised equipment
  • cleaning of fixtures and fittings
  • replenishment of consumables.

Teaching rooms and meeting rooms are cleaned daily.

Cleaning includes removal of litter and cleaning of

  • floors
  • table surfaces
  • whiteboards and trays
  • keyboards, screens and cables
  • fold-down desk surfaces in lecture halls (cleaned monthly).

Deep cleaning

Deep cleaning of the University’s premises is carried out every summer. This cleaning is more extensive than the regular weekly cleaning.

Before the work begins, the contact person will receive information about dates, times and any necessary preparations. Notices will also be displayed in entrances, corridors and lifts.

Surfaces and fittings

  • Removal of stickers as well as tape and adhesive residues.
  • Removal of stains from walls and doors.
  • Cleaning of doors, handles, frames and light switches.
  • Cleaning of glass panels in doors and walls.
  • Cleaning of tables and other exposed horizontal surfaces.
  • Cleaning of noticeboards, picture rails, window sills and open shelving.

Floors and ventilation

  • Vacuuming and damp mopping of floors.
  • Cleaning of floor drains in shower rooms.
  • Cleaning of radiators, including behind the radiators.
  • Cleaning of cable trays, pipes and ventilation fixtures.
  • Cleaning of light fittings.

Kitchenettes and common areas

  • Vacuuming of sofas in kitchenettes, lunchrooms and communal areas.
  • Cleaning of waste bins.
  • Cleaning of kitchenettes, including worktops, sinks, taps, tiled surfaces and areas around microwave ovens.

Toilets and changing rooms

  • Cleaning of toilets and changing rooms, including sanitary ware, mirrors, the exterior of lockers/cabinets and shower areas.
  • Refilling of consumables in kitchenettes and toilets.
  • Replacement of toilet brushes when necessary.

What is not included:

  • cleaning of refrigerators
  • cleaning of microwave ovens, except in student areas
  • cleaning of office chairs.

Floor care

Floor care is carried out during the summer. The work is completed in stages to minimise disruption to ongoing activities. Before the work begins, the contact person will receive information about dates, times and any necessary preparations.

Mark rooms that should not receive floor care

If a room should not receive floor care, a notice must be placed on the door stating: “No floor care in this room”.

  • Remove everything from the floor.
  • Label furniture with the room number.

For best results, the floor should be completely clear. Furniture on wheels will be moved by the contractor. If any items remain in the room, polish will be applied around them.

Environmental certification

Stockholm University is environmentally certified. All chemical products, except for graffiti removal and polish removal, comply with the Nordic Swan Ecolabel or equivalent.

The contractors are certified in accordance with SS EN ISO 14001.
